Ordered a dry 肉骨大虾 kway teow ($5) with a mix of prawns and pork ribs. The pork ribs are extremely tender and the meat comes off the bone easily, together with a slight amount of soft rendered fats, ensuring the meat isn’t dry and hard but retaining a good texture and moisture. Prawns are halved before cooking and easily peels from the shells. The soup is rich and full of prawn flavours and the kway teow tossed in charred onions, dried chili and pork oil makes for a really satisfying meal.
.
Waiting time is about 10-15 minutes at lunch hour, but it’s well worth the wait and a definite stop-by for your prawn noodle cravings!

Our go-to chillout bar - TAP offers some fantastic craft beers on tap that are going for just $10 daily.
.
Just a decade ago, the beer options here were limited to Carlsberg, Tiger, Heineken.. Today, the craft beer scene is booming, and TAP Craft Beer Bar offers an eclectic selection of beers across the globe, and these pints of Dead Guy’s Ale and Maisel's Hefeweizen are just some of the great options on tap.
.
Dead Guy’s Ale is a toffee, hoppy, honey ale that’s best for a strong end to a long day at work. A clear amber, the liquid is mildly sweet and malty with small hints of orange peel.
.
The latter is a refreshing amber with a classic aroma and flavours including fruity banana notes, orange zest, slight nuances of nutmeg and clove. It's light, crisp, with a liveliness and refreshing tartness.
.
TAP is a low-key chillout spot to unwind after a day's work. They have just opened an outlet along the waters at Robertson Quay. Love the relaxed atmosphere here. Spacious on the inside with a small patio overlooking the river outside. There’s even a great bottle selection from Thirsty! An ideal location to grab a couple of friends for some pints and laugh over some quality talks 😉

Penang Delights has been around for at least 10 years, always been the go-to place for a good prawn mee fix. When we visited today, we were greeted by a younger lady, probably the daughter of the original stall owner. A grumpy old man, he used to dish out bowls of prawn noodles with a flavour so rich that would keep us yearning for the same taste every month.
.
This bowl of dry prawn mee takes the cut with it’s spicy blend of chili and fried shallots. The noodles are topped with pork and prawns, and splashed with a ladle of rich prawn soup. The accompanying broth has a rich sweetness, the result of boiling prawn heads and pork bones for long hours. It’s less rich when we tried it today compared to the old days, but still retains its sweetness.
.
Though not the best we’ve tasted, it’s a definite visit if you’re in the area!
